Norwich City manager Chris Hughton says he’s been ‘very impressed’ with Swansea City this season.

After a rather slow start to the season, the Canaries are now on a par with Swansea City in terms of recent form, as both teams are unbeaten in the last six with 3 wins and 3 draws. Norwich in fact are unbeaten in the last 8, and that includes a 1-0 win at home against Manchester United.

Talking about his side’s opposition this Saturday, Hughton told the club’s official site:

“I`ve been very impressed with Swansea, not only because of the run they`re on, but also the style of football that they`re playing.

“I thought they were very good last season, but they`ve added a bit and brought in players that have done very well in the team.

“The manager has used his experience in the Spanish market, he knows the players very well, and they`ve all hit the ground running – in particular Michu, who is scoring goals at a very good rate.

“Swansea are playing an exciting brand of football, and are probably playing as well as anybody in this division.

“With each game comes a team threat and an individual threat. We must make sure we`re as resilient as possible, but also that we have a threat ourselves.

“It`s not about one player, it`s about the whole team, and we`ll certainly have to make sure that we`re on our game to get something from it.’


The Swans face a tough match at home this weekend against a side who are now proving hard to beat – like they were last year under former boss Paul Lambert.

Both sides will be full of confidence but if Swansea City are at their best – like they have been in recent games – there’ll probably be only one winner. If Norwich did win, it would be their first away victory of the season.
